What is the average MOT pass rate for a Alfa Romeo Gtv?

The Alfa Romeo Gtv has an average 72.8% MOT pass rate across model years 1971 to 2018, based on DVSA test data.

What are the most common MOT failures on a Alfa Romeo Gtv?

The most common MOT failure reasons for the Alfa Romeo Gtv across all years are: a suspension pin, bush or joint excessively worn, a spring or spring component fractured or seriously weakened, a wheel bearing with excessive play. These are typical wear items that can often be checked and addressed before your test.
